How they compare

Mozambique currently reports 3.61 billion against 2.75 billion in Papua New Guinea, a difference of 859.07 million.

That makes Mozambique's figure about 1.3 times Papua New Guinea's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 20 shared years of data; in 2005 it was Papua New Guinea ahead.

Mozambique ranks 45th and Papua New Guinea ranks 48th of 197 countries.

Papua New Guinea has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
